Tour Details

New Orleans Sightseeing Flight offers a choice of 30-minute, 45-minute, or 60-minute flights.
Our professional pilot, certified by the FAA with 20,000 hours of experience, provides live commentary as you soar over iconic landmarks.
The rental of aviation headsets, pilot gratuity, hotel pickup/drop-off, and potential fuel surcharges are all included in the tour.
You’ll meet us at 6575 Stars and Stripes Blvd, New Orleans, LA 70126.
To participate, you’ll need a minimum of 2 people, and a maximum of 3.
Children under 5 require a DOT-approved car seat, and the combined weight can’t exceed 450 lbs.

Booking and Participation Requirements

To book your sightseeing flight, we’ll need to meet a few requirements.
The minimum booking is for 2 people, with a maximum of 3. Minors must be accompanied by an adult, and children under 2 can sit on laps. Kids under 5 need a DOT-approved car seat, which you’ll need to provide.
There’s also a weight limit – the combined weight mustn’t exceed 450 lbs, with a per-person limit of 300 lbs.
Finally, you’ll need to bring a valid photo ID when you arrive.
Keep in mind, flights may be rescheduled due to weather, and refunds aren’t provided.
